Failed findings

  • surfaces not properly sanitized
    Official wording: Food-Contact Surfaces: Cleaned & Sanitized
    Inspector note: OBSERVED THE INTERIOR UPPER WATER RESERVOIR AND INSIDE ICE BIN OF THE ICE MACHINE WITH BLACK AND PINK SLIME SUBSTANCE. INSTRUCTED TO CLEAN AND SANITIZE ALL INTERIOR ICE CONTACT SURFACES OF MACHINE. PRIORITY FOUNDATION VIOLATION 7-38-005 CITATION ISSUED.
    code 16
  • food improperly labeled
    Official wording: Food Properly Labeled; Original Container
    Inspector note: ALL BULK FOODS NOT IN THE ORIGINAL CONTAINER MUST BE LABELED WITH THE PRODUCT COMMON NAME.
    code 37
  • grimy wiping cloths
    Official wording: Wiping Cloths: Properly Used & Stored
    Inspector note: PREP AREA WIPING CLOTHS MUST BE HELD IN A CONTAINER WITH A SANITIZING SOLUTION.
    code 41
  • surfaces / setup not up to code
    Official wording: Food & Non-Food Contact Surfaces Cleanable, Properly Designed, Constructed & Used
    Inspector note: MUST NOT USE TAPE AS A MEANS OF REPAIR FOR THE DISH MACHINE.
    code 47
  • Hot & Cold Water Available; Adequate Pressure
    Inspector note: NO COLD WATER PRESSURE IS AVAILABLE AT THE COOKS LINE HAND WASHING SINK. ON STAFF MAINTENANCE MAN ON SITE REPAIRED THE SINK AND RESTORED THE COLD WATER BY THE END OF THE INSPECTION. REVIEWED WITH MANAGEMENT, HOT AND COLD RUNNING WATER MUST BE AVAILABLE AT ALL TIMES AT ALL HANDWASHING SINKS. PRIORITY VIOLATION 7-38-030(C) CITATION ISSUED.
    code 50
  • Toilet Facilities: Properly Constructed, Supplied, & Cleaned
    Inspector note: MUST PROVIDE A COVERED WASTE RECEPTACLE IN THE WOMEN'S WASHROOM.
    code 53
  • Garbage & Refuse Properly Disposed; Facilities Maintained
    Inspector note: MUST PROVIDE WASTE RECEPTACLES AT ALL HAND WASHING SINKS.
    code 54
  • floors, walls, or ceilings grimy
    Official wording: Physical Facilities Installed, Maintained & Clean
    Inspector note: NOTED WATER DAMAGED CEILING TILES IN BOTH THE MENS AND WOMENS WASHROOMS. MUST REPLACE.
    code 55
